Flea bites

The usual reaction of human skin to a flea bite is the formation of a small red circle with a dot in the center, a slight swelling and a lot of itching.

Fleas are external parasites that feed on the blood of mammals, dogs and cats in particular, but often also bite humans. These stings can be caused in the legs or ankles.

Some people get bitten by fleas multiple times. Others (possibly living in the same house) appear not to be the preferred target of these parasites. This appears to be related to the lack of vitamins in the body.

Two things are fundamental when it comes to flea bites: keep the area clean and avoid scratching  (which is difficult when the itching becomes intense). To achieve the first goal, an antiseptic or simply soap with cold water should be applied to the skin, as hot water can increase swelling.

If you do not keep the area clean and if the person scratches, there is a risk of opening the wound causing secondary infections.

Medical treatments

If the sting produces pronounced itching and swelling, creams such as hydrocortisone, an over-the-counter medication, can be applied.

Homemade remedies

There are several natural remedies to relieve itching caused by flea bites  and they are quite well known. Various natural products can also be used that contribute to skin health.

One option would be to mix baking soda with a few drops of water to form a paste to apply to the sting area.  Let it act on the skin for 15-30 minutes to calm the annoying itchy sensation.

Another would be to boil the peel of 1 lemon in 250 cc of water, let the liquid rest and then apply it with cotton or gauze on the affected area.  

Another classic natural remedy to get rid of itching is to mix two tablespoons of water and one tablespoon of apple cider vinegar. It is necessary to keep everything in the fridge for a few hours and apply it on the sting.

In the event that the rash were to be severe, prolonged over time or other complications should arise, a doctor should be consulted.

Although flea bites in general do not cause serious consequences, they  can sometimes cause allergic reactions. In addition, fleas can transmit dangerous diseases such as typhus or bubonic plague.

Find the definitive solution

dog and fleas

Finally, the outcome of the treatment against flea bites, or the relief obtained for the itch, will never be the definitive solution to the problem.

To avoid bites, fleas must be eliminated, there are several products to fight them and your vet can recommend the best remedy for your pets. Until you take great care of your four-legged friends, there will also be fleas because they are the natural habitat of these parasites.
